Transaction 7964041b5d406ae43da177169ef670537335fe49e91524385f6d80444f8f90b7
1 Input
1 Output
-
7964041b5d406ae43da177169ef670537335fe49e91524385f6d80444f8f90b7:0
- value
- 390000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b340aeb4a07db2263aee0db3d1c0fe2536c44490 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HLoSZ41XsiCqvaVKeCwFuwdfLgfWU5oGn